Hinges are necessary for a strong, secure door that operates in a way that minimizes the risk of draughts. But they also require regular maintenance and adjustments in order to work smoothly throughout the years.
Most uPVC doors have flag hinges. One is that is attached to the door's edge or profile and the other fixed on the frame. These can be adjusted both vertically and laterally to accommodate the movement of the sash that is on the door.
Faulty locks
The locks on your conservatory are a crucial part of keeping your home secure, so if you find that they're not functioning correctly it's crucial to fix it immediately. Your locks may not be functioning properly due to various reasons. Certain of these issues can be fixed yourself, while others require the help of a professional.
The misalignment between the latch and the door is one of the most common causes for an insecure lock. This happens over time if the hinges loosen or were not screwed in tight enough in the initial place. To fix this, tightening your hinges is an easy fix. However, it's important to do it slowly to avoid damaging your door or hinges.
The most frequent issue is that the lock simply stopped working. This can happen for a variety of reasons, such as the key snapping in the lock or the internal components of the mechanism. Locksmiths will have to replace the parts in this case.
The lock may also stop working if it becomes stuck in the locked position. This can be caused by a number of factors, such as dirt or grime that has built up in the keyhole or lock. A quick wipe with a damp towel will help get rid of any accumulation and allow the locks to work properly.
Make sure the keyhole hasn't been blocked by furniture or other objects. This can be difficult to determine. If the keyhole appears be clear, then you can apply a small amount of graphite lubricant in order to make it move more smoothly. This is an excellent alternative to oil or grease because they can cause the lock overheat and then break down. Utilizing a graphite powder is the most effective way to care for your door as it's gentler on the door's frame than other fluids.
Hinges damaged by abrasions
As time passes the hinges on your door may become damaged and start to fail. It is crucial to fix your hinges before they get too damaged, whether this is because of an impact or age.
The hinge could be damaged if your conservatory door handle starts to spin when you shut or open the door. Some people suggest lubricating a hinge with graphite or oil, but this is not always a permanent solution. Replace the screws that hold the hinge in place with larger, more durable ones.
Flag hinges are the most popular uPVC u-channel door hinges. This hinge joins the door sash to the frame and provides stability and security. It's also suitable for large loads. They're available in a variety of sizes and finishes. They can be easily fixed.
Alternately, you can choose to use a butt hinge. These are designed to be used on timber doors and can support a sash weight of 50kg per hinge. They're available in a number of different finishes and can be easily fitted to your uPVC door.
In some cases the hinges on your conservatory door hinge replacement door could have been damaged as a a result of impact or ageing. In this scenario you'll have to replace your hinges prior to they completely break. It's a simple task that requires just the use of a screwdriver, other tools and the screwdriver.
However, it's essential to know what kind of hinge you need prior to purchasing any replacements. To make sure that your hinge is the right size, you'll need measure the distance between two pins. You must also think about the weight of the sash, and the number of hinges required to support it.
Verify that your screws are the proper length. They should be at least three inches long for hinges with external hinges to ensure they can grasp the frame of the door and jamb securely. They won't be able secure the hinge, and could push the door or window through.
Leaky Seals
All doors, regardless of whether they are made of wood, uPVC or aluminum, should be sealed properly. Water can leak into the conservatory doors repairs and cause costly damage to the structure and any furniture. It is essential to examine the doorframe, weatherstripping, and seals to check for signs of wear. This also includes examining the ground leading to the door, the condition of the roof above and the presence of trees or other plants that may affect drainage patterns.
Several factors can contribute to leaky doors for conservatories, including structural issues like soil settling or shifting foundations. This could cause misalignment between the door and frame, which can lead to gaps through which water or air can enter through. A professional should be sought out to assess the issue and make any necessary repairs to stop leaks.
It is important to examine the condition of weatherstripping and seals, but also to check connections and hinges to determine whether they are showing signs of wear. These areas are more vulnerable to condensation or moisture because of their frequent contact and movement. Regular maintenance, like cleaning and lubricating parts can stop them from wearing out or deteriorating over time.
Leaks can cause more only structural damage to your conservatory. They can also result in high heating bills during the winter months and scorching temperatures in summer. Damp and mold can harm fabrics and cause health issues. Poor Security
Many homeowners think that conservatories pose a security threat and make it easier for burglars to get into their homes. It is possible to increase the security of your conservatory by making a few minor changes, such as locking the doors. Installing a multi-point locking system is the most common method of securing a uPVC uPVC. These locks are equipped with multiple points that will activate simultaneously when a person attempts to open them. These types of locks can be resistant to more rigorous attacks than single-point locks.
Installing a high security handle is a different way to secure your conservatory. These handles are designed to be compatible to new multi-point locking system and are rated TS007 to protect against forced entrance. Lack of lubrication or an uneven pressure distribution on the door and frame are usually responsible for the squeaky hinges. Hairspray is a great option to spray the hinges with polymers which form a protective coating and reduce friction. Other causes of squeaky door hinges include loose screws and changes in humidity. Wood tends to expand and contract in response to changes in moisture levels, which could cause the frame and door to move slightly which can result in them rubbing against each other and creating loud squeaking sounds.
Finally the uPVC door might not be installed correctly. It could need to adjusted. The hinges' screws that hold them in place could be loose and require to be tightened. It's a good idea make use of a fixing jig when changing the hinges to ensure that they are in the proper position and remain in place. You can also use a screwdriver to tighten the screws that control vertical and lateral movement. The screw at the top of a hinge for flags typically controls lateral adjustment, while the one at the bottom is used to adjust compression.
